The **Masterclass Certificate in Accessible Arts Technology** is a program designed to equip learners with the skills needed for a successful career in the arts technology field. This section features a 3D pie chart that highlights the job market trends in the UK for various roles related to this certificate. The chart shows that **Web Developer** roles account for 25% of the jobs in the arts technology field. This role involves creating websites and web applications for various clients, and requires skills such as HTML, CSS, JavaScript, and web accessibility. **Graphic Designer** roles account for 20% of the jobs in this field. These professionals create visual content for various media, including digital and print. They need skills such as Adobe Creative Suite, typography, and color theory. **UX/UI Designer** roles account for 18% of the jobs. These designers create user-friendly interfaces for websites, apps, and other digital products. They need skills such as user research, wireframing, prototyping, and usability testing. **Animator** roles account for 15% of the jobs. These professionals create animations for various media, including movies, TV shows, and websites. They need skills such as storytelling, character design, and animation software. **Video Editor** roles account for 12% of the jobs. These editors create and assemble video content for various media, including movies, TV shows, and social media. They need skills such as video editing software, storytelling, and color grading. **Audio Engineer** roles account for 10% of the jobs. These engineers record, mix, and master audio content for various media, including music, podcasts, and video games. They need skills such as audio recording equipment, sound design, and audio editing software.
